As the maverick politician Enoch Powell, famously said in 1977 ‘all political lives end in failure’.

 On the Laura Kuenssberg programme this morning on BBC One, we had the cabinet minister Peter Kyle, a close friend of the prime minister - giving a robust defence of his boss, Keir Starmer. Nevertheless he conceded that the prime minister was reflecting on the ‘political realities’. This was a coded message that the game was up. It’s now anticipated Keir Starmer, will set out a timeline for his departure from Downing Street and very probably by the September Labour Party conference. This will give time for a proper discussion about values and vision for the country. Hopefully there will be others like Wes Streeting to - put in a bid for the leadership. As we reflect on the premiership of the prime minister, the famous words of Enoch Powell MP (1912-1998) - couldn’t be more apposite ‘all political lives end in failure’.
